9-E 2021-687 Consider Adoption of Urgency Ordinance or Introduction of Ordinance
Amending the Alameda Municipal Code by Adding Section 4-61
(Grocery Worker Hazard Pay) to Require Large Grocery Stores in
Alameda to Pay Employees an Additional Five Dollars ($5.00) per
Hour in Hazard Pay during the Novel Coronavirus (COVID-19)
Pandemic and to Include Enforcement of Emergency Hazard Pay to
Grocery Employees. (Vice Mayor Vella and Councilmember Knox
White) [Not heard on March 2, 2021]

• KNOW YOUR RIGHTS UNDER THE SUNSHINE ORDINANCE: Government’s duty is to
serve the public, reaching its decisions in full view of the public. Commissions, boards,
councils and other agencies of the City of Alameda exist to conduct the citizen of
Alameda’s business. This ordinance assures that deliberations are conducted before the
people and that City operations are open to the people’s review.
